Who Should Consult A Breast Surgeon In Mumbai For Evaluation Or Treatment?
Anyone with a new breast lump, persistent nipple discharge, skin changes or abnormal screening should consult a breast
surgeon in Mumbai. Those with hereditary risk factors or prior atypical pathology should seek specialist advice about
surveillance and preventive options. The breast surgeon evaluates whether breast surgery or further diagnostics are
needed and arranges multidisciplinary care.
How Consulting A Breast Surgeon In Mumbai Helps In Early Detection And Prevention?
Early referral enables prompt imaging and biopsy, increasing the likelihood of breast conserving surgery and less
invasive treatment. Surgeons also advise on genetic testing, risk‑reducing strategies and surveillance for high‑risk
patients.
Common Signs And Lumps That Require Examination By A Breast Surgeon
New lumps, skin dimpling, nipple inversion or bloody discharge should prompt evaluation by a breast surgeon in
Mumbai. Even small lumps may need breast lump surgery if they change or cause symptoms.
Seeking Advice From A Breast Surgeon For Breast Pain Or Discharge
Breast pain and discharge are often benign, but a breast surgeon will assess symptoms, order imaging and recommend
conservative or surgical treatment if structural issues are found.
Role Of A Breast Surgeon In Treating Benign Conditions Like Fibroadenoma
For fibroadenomas, the breast surgeon in Mumbai may recommend observation, minimally invasive excision or breast
fibroadenoma surgery when lesions are symptomatic or diagnostically uncertain.
Things To Know Before Visiting A Breast Surgeon In Mumbai For The First Time
Bring prior imaging and biopsy reports, medication lists and family history. Expect a focused exam, review of imaging
and discussion of diagnostic options. The breast surgeon will explain surgical choices, breast conserving surgery,
mastectomy, sentinel node biopsy, and reconstructive possibilities, and outline recovery expectations and follow‑up.
How Does A Breast Surgeon In Mumbai Diagnose Lumps, Tumors, And Breast Conditions?
Diagnosis combines clinical exams with mammography, ultrasound and image‑guided biopsy. A breast surgeon in
Mumbai interprets pathology to stage disease and plan appropriate breast surgery, coordinating with oncology for
adjuvant treatment when necessary.
Tests And Imaging Techniques Used By Breast Surgeons In Mumbai
Diagnostic mammography, targeted ultrasound, MRI for selected cases and core needle biopsy are standard. These
tests guide planning for breast lump removal surgery and oncologic resections.
Mammography, Ultrasound, And Biopsy Procedures For Accurate Detection
Mammography and ultrasound identify suspicious lesions; core needle biopsy confirms diagnosis and receptor status before breast cancer surgery.
How To Prepare For A Diagnostic Consultation With A Breast Surgeon?
Bring prior reports and avoid lotions before imaging. Prepare questions about treatment options and recovery.
Laboratory And Imaging Tests Used Before Breast Surgery In Mumbai
Preoperative workup may include blood tests, ECG if indicated, and repeat imaging to map the lesion for breast lump
surgery.
What Types Of Breast Surgeries Are Performed By Surgeons In Mumbai?
Breast surgeons perform lumpectomy, mastectomy, sentinel node biopsy, axillary dissection and reconstructive
procedures. They also manage infections with breast abscess surgery and excise benign lesions like fibroadenomas.
Common Procedures – Lumpectomy, Mastectomy, And Breast Reconstruction
Lumpectomy preserves breast tissue while removing the tumour; mastectomy removes more tissue and may be chosen
for extensive disease. Reconstruction options, implant or flap, are discussed with the breast surgeon in Mumbai and
plastic surgery colleagues.
What Symptoms Or Conditions Suggest The Need To Visit A Breast Surgeon In Mumbai?
Persistent lumps, suspicious imaging, biopsy‑proven malignancy, recurrent infections or symptomatic benign lesions
indicate the need for specialist evaluation and possible breast surgery.
What Treatments And Procedures Are Offered By Breast Surgeons In Mumbai?
Services include diagnostic biopsies, breast lump removal surgery, breast cancer removal surgery, sentinel node biopsy,
oncoplastic reconstruction and management of benign disease including fibroadenoma breast surgery and breast abscess
surgery.
Non-Surgical And Conservative Treatment Options Managed By Breast Specialists
Conservative care includes cyst aspiration, antibiotics and active surveillance for small benign lesions; breast
conservation surgery with adjuvant therapy is often preferred for early cancer.

Can a Breast Surgeon Treat Both Cancerous and Non-Cancerous Lumps?
Yes. A breast surgeon in Mumbai manages benign and malignant lesions and coordinates oncology care when cancer is diagnosed.
What Is the Difference Between Breast Conservation Surgery and Mastectomy?
Breast conservation surgery removes the tumour and a margin of tissue, usually followed by radiation; mastectomy removes most or all breast tissue.
Is Oncoplastic Breast Surgery Available in Mumbai?
Yes. Many breast surgeons in Mumbais offer oncoplastic breast surgery to combine tumour removal with cosmetic reconstruction.

Do Breast Surgeons Offer Reconstructive Options After Mastectomy?
Yes. Reconstruction can be immediate or delayed and uses implants or autologous tissue.
What Follow-Up Care Is Advised After Visiting a Breast Doctor Near Me?
Follow‑up includes wound checks, pathology review and imaging surveillance; your breast doctor near me will provide a schedule.
Can Breast Surgeons Perform Minimally Invasive Lump Removal Procedures?
Yes. Image‑guided excisions and localization techniques minimise tissue removal for selected lesions.
Do Breast Surgeons Handle Fibroadenoma and Benign Cyst Surgeries?
Yes. Fibroadenoma breast surgery and cyst excision are common when lesions are symptomatic or growing.
How Long Does It Take to Recover After Breast Surgery?
Recovery varies by procedure; minor excisions heal quickly while cancer surgery with reconstruction requires longer recovery.
